Long before digital sensors, engineers relied on precision and simple tools to collect critical data. Workers manually recorded each hammer strike on graph paper as foundation piles were driven into the ground. Known as pile calendaring, the method estimates a pile's load-bearing capacity by measuring movement after each impact. Even today, it remains a trusted way to verify modern sensor data.
